ER & ICU Registered Veterinary Technician

Hourly Payrate: $21.00 - $35.00 (Dependent on Experience and Skill Set)

EVS asks all RVT candidates to complete a Technician Leveling Test during the interview process. This test measures math skills, critical thinking, and medication administration for RVT levels I, II & III.

Job Summary:

This technician is a vital member of the Emergency and Intensive Care Unit (ICU) teams, supporting compassionate, high-quality care for critically ill and emergent patients. They work closely with ER and ICU doctors to triage and stabilize emergencies, manage hospitalized ICU cases, and assist with procedures such as catheter placement, laceration repair, oxygen therapy (including high-flow), and thoracocentesis. The ideal candidate has a strong foundation in emergency and critical care medicine, medical math, and clinical reasoning, with a calm, focused approach under pressure. They understand the long-term needs of ICU patients, including nutrition support, transfusions, and fluid therapy. Above all, they bring a passion for patient care, a commitment to learning, and a collaborative, team-oriented mindset.

  • Preferred: Experience with handling and treating ZCA patients. Job Duties & Responsibilities:
    • Greet clients and obtain thorough patient histories, body weights, and vital signs for patients.
    • Recognize abnormal physical exam findings and communicate concerns clearly to the DVM.
    • Perform triage assessments and identify emergent conditions or subtle changes in clinical status.
    • Participate in care planning, demonstrating critical thinking and anticipating patient and DVM needs.
    • Perform venipuncture from multiple sites (cephalic, jugular, lateral/medial saphenous), and place/maintain IV catheters and central/sampling lines.
    • Administer medications via IV, IM, SQ, and PO with understanding of drug classes, routes, and side effects.
    • Calculate drug dosages, additives (KCl, dextrose), and CRIs including fentanyl, Reglan, and pressors; demonstrate strong knowledge of medical math.
    • Perform and monitor blood transfusions, including blood typing, crossmatching, and recognizing transfusion reactions.
    • Run and interpret in-house diagnostics (PCV/TS, glucose, lactate, blood gases, coags, cytology, VCM, fecals, ketones).
    • Use and troubleshoot lab equipment (Heska, IDEXX, Abaxis); prepare samples for submission to reference labs.
    • Set up and manage oxygen therapy (nasal cannulas, Snyder cages, high-flow O2, peripheral oxygen cages).
    • Recognize changes in respiratory effort, patterns, and sounds; escalate concerns appropriately.
    • Perform radiographs including horizontal beam with appropriate positioning while maintaining safety standards.
    • Anesthesia induction, intubation, monitoring, and recovery of patients undergoing procedures, recognizing concerns/abnormalities with ETCO2, SpO2, ECG, heart rate, blood pressure, and respiratory rate; independently run anesthesia on ASA IIII patients and assist or preference for proficiency in running anesthesia with ASA IVV cases.
    • Place and maintain feeding tubes (NG, NE), urinary catheters, and central/sampling lines. Set up for placement of and maintain chest tubes, Jackson-Pratt drains, and E-tubes.
    • Calculate and monitor nutritional needs, including RER and dietary restrictions for specific disease states.
    • Perform wound care, assist with procedures (laceration repair, biopsies, abdominocentesis, thoracocentesis), and maintain sterile fields.
    • Prepare and assist DVM with emergency interventions (gastric lavage, trocarization, scope procedures).
    • Recognize and support patients with critical conditions (IMHA, ITP, DKA, CHF, CKD, snake envenomation).
    • Demonstrate curiosity and initiative by investigating unfamiliar medications, procedures, or diseases.
    • Provide medical care and husbandry support to ZCA species; administer medications and assist with diagnostics.
    • Educate clients on treatment plans, discharge instructions, medication administration, and follow-up care.
    • Communicate effectively with clients, including updates on hospitalized or emergency patients.
    • Actively listen and participate in patient rounds and collaborative cross-departmental case discussions.
    • Ensure complete and accurate documentation and charging in Instinct and Ezyvet.
    • Maintain a clean, organized, and safe hospital environment.
    • Proficient in CPR Recover protocols and roles including chest compressions, intubation, ventilation, drug administration, ECG use, and recording.
    • Maintain Cubex proficiency with minimal discrepancies. Other duties as assigned; this list is not exhaustive, & employer reserves the right to assign additional tasks & responsibilities as needed.
